How Course Key Login Works
The Course Key Login system operates on a simple yet robust principle. Each course is assigned a unique key or code, which is provided to enrolled students. This key is then used to authenticate the student’s identity and grant access to the respective course materials. The system is typically integrated with the learning management system (LMS) of the educational institution, making it easy to manage course enrollments and access permissions. Security is a paramount feature of the Course Key Login, as it employs advanced encryption methods to protect user data and prevent unauthorized access.
